My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Greetings from the Crypt! My name is Pepperoni, and despite my worried expression, I'm a lover and a friend to all. My journey to Animal Aid has been full of bumps and twists, but I'm so ready to retire for good with my new family. I originally grew up in California and traveled to Oregon with a good samaritan who found me living outside, severely neglected. I was covered in dense, painful mats, and I had not had any vet care in quite some time. When I was finally rescued and got the care I needed, a loud heart murmur was discovered. I have since gone to the cardiologist and started treatment for a degenerative heart condition. This means I will need to take my heart meds for the rest of my life.

I'm already feeling so much better and have been enjoying new adventures. I'm great with dogs of all sizes, cats, and kids who can take things slow with me at first. I love to cuddle up with a cozy blanket and my favorite person. Even though I'm in my senior years, I still enjoy going on walks and seeing new places, though you may need to carry me up and down stairs. I'm fully potty trained and don't mind being alone for short periods of time.

I'm preparing for a dental to get my bad teeth removed, so I will be ready to go to a new home when my mouth is feeling better.

Ready to meet the peaceful BFF of your dreams? I'm in a foster home, so please fill out an application to visit me.

More about this shelter

Animal Aid of Portland is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it animal rescue and welfare organization, passionately serving animals and the people they love since 1969. It is our mission to enhance the welfare of companion animals through individualized care and lifelong commitment, rescue and adoption, resources and education, and community partnerships. We operate a free-roam shelter for cats; a foster program for dogs and cats; It Takes a Pack, a community-driven animal care supply sharing initiative; and the Animal Aid Cares Fund, a partnership with veterinarians, trainers, and behaviorists in Portland to provide financial assistance for urgent medical and behavioral care.
